We are looking for a highly skilled Senior React Developer to join our team and lead the development of dynamic, user-friendly web applications. The ideal candidate will have extensive experience with React and a strong understanding of modern front-end technologies.
Responsibilities:
- Design, develop, and maintain interactive web applications using React.
- Collaborate with UX/UI designers and backend developers to create seamless user experiences.
- Optimize application performance and ensure responsiveness across devices.
- Write clean, maintainable, and efficient code following best practices.
- Mentor junior developers and lead code reviews.
Requirements:
- Proven experience with React and Redux, including state management and component lifecycle.
- Strong knowledge of JavaScript, HTML, and CSS.
- Experience with RESTful APIs and integrating with backend services.
- Familiarity with version control systems (e.g., Git) and build tools (e.g., Webpack).
- Excellent problem-solving skills and attention to detail.
Preferred:
- Experience with TypeScript and modern JavaScript frameworks.
- Knowledge of testing frameworks and methodologies (e.g., Jest, React Testing Library).
- Familiarity with CI/CD pipelines and automated deployment processes.
If you are passionate about React and excited to work on cutting-edge projects, we’d love to hear from you. Apply today!